leaping

简明释义

[ˈliːpɪŋ][ˈliːpɪŋ]

adj. 跳跃的,跳跃而行的

n. 跳跃

v. 跳跃(leap 的 ing 形式)

英英释义

The action of jumping or springing into the air.

跳起或弹起的动作。

To move quickly and suddenly from one place to another.

迅速而突然地从一个地方移动到另一个地方。

单词用法

by leaps and bounds

adv. 飞跃地,突飞猛进地

leap forward

跃进;向前跳;快速发展
